Loop Capital Trims Altice USA (NYSE:ATUS) Target Price to $2.00

Altice USA (NYSE:ATUSGet Free Report) had its price objective cut by research analysts at Loop Capital from $3.00 to $2.00 in a research note issued on Tuesday, Benzinga reports. The firm currently has a “hold” rating on the stock. Loop Capital’s price target points to a potential upside of 3.68% from the company’s previous close.

Several other equities analysts also recently weighed in on ATUS. Benchmark reiterated a “buy” rating and set a $5.00 target price on shares of Altice USA in a research report on Wednesday, March 20th. BNP Paribas lowered Altice USA from a “neutral” rating to an “underperform” rating and set a $1.00 target price for the company. in a research note on Tuesday, April 9th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. reissued an “underweight” rating on shares of Altice USA in a report on Thursday, April 11th. Wells Fargo & Company downgraded Altice USA from an “equal weight” rating to an “underweight” rating and reduced their price target for the company from $2.00 to $1.00 in a report on Friday, April 5th. Finally, UBS Group reduced their price target on Altice USA from $6.00 to $4.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a report on Thursday, February 15th. Four investment anal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, three have assigned a hold rating and two have given a bu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$2.80.

Altice USA Trading Up 0.5 %

Shares of NYSE ATUS traded up $0.01 during trading on Tuesday, reaching $1.93. The company had a trading volume of 384,028 shares, compared to its average volume of 4,054,256. Altice USA has a twelve month low of $1.75 and a twelve month high of $3.82. The stock has a market capitalization of $879.86 million, a PE ratio of 16.08 and a beta of 1.35.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$2.42 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$2.52.

Altice USA (NYSE:ATUSG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 14th. The company reported ($0.26)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.07 by ($0.33). Altice USA had a negative return on equity of 12.81% and a net margin of 0.58%. The company had revenue of $2.30 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.29 billion. During the same period last year, the firm earned ($0.43) earnings per share. The business’s revenue was down 2.9%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ts predict that Altice USA will post 0.19 EPS for the current year.

Altice USA,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ides broadband communications and video services in the United States, Canada, Puerto Rico, and the Virgin Islands. It offers broadband, video, telephony, and mobile services to residential and business customers. The company's video services include delivery of broadcast stations and cable networks; over the top services; video-on-demand, high-definition channels, digital video recorder, and pay-per-view services; and platforms for video programming through mobile applications.
